Senior Backend Developer
Role: Senior Backend Developer
Type:Fixed Term Employment (1year)
Location: UK (Remote)
Client:Tavant Technologies
Mandatory Skills - Java, Spring Boot
Experience 8+ years
Job Description
We are looking for a Senior Backend Developer with strong experience in Java, Spring Boot, microservices architecturesto design, build, and scale backend systems in a cloud-native environment. The role requires a hands-on engineer who can deliver high-quality services, collaborate across teams, and contribute to architectural and design decisions.
Roles & Responsibilities
- Design, develop, and maintain scalable backend servicesusing Java and Spring Boot
- Build and support microservices-based architectureswith high availability and performance
- Develop and consume RESTful APIsand event-driven services
- Collaborate with frontend, DevOps, and product teams to deliver end-to-end solutions
- Participate in design discussions, code reviews, and technical decision-making
- Ensure code quality through unit testing, integration testing, and best practices
- Troubleshoot and resolve production issues and performance bottlenecks
- Contribute to continuous improvement of engineering standards and processes
Technical Skills
- 8+ yearsof hands-on backend development experience
- Strong proficiency in Java (8+) and Spring Boot
- Solid experience designing and implementing microservices architectures
- Experience with REST APIs, messaging, and asynchronous processing
- Hands-on experience with cloud platforms(AWS / Azure / GCP)
- Good experience in SQL and NoSQL databases
- Familiarity with CI/CD pipelines, Git, and build tools
- Experience with Docker and containerized deployment
JBRP1_UKTJ